Overview of Itoprid PMCS

What is Itoprid PMCS?

Itoprid PMCS is a medication classified as a prokinetic agent. It is primarily used to manage symptoms associated with impaired gastrointestinal motility, specifically focusing on the upper digestive tract. The active substance in this medication is itopride hydrochloride.

Mechanism of Action

The medication works by enhancing the movement and contractions of the stomach and intestines. It achieves this through a dual action approach:

  • Dopamine Antagonism: It blocks dopamine D2 receptors, which helps prevent the inhibition of gastrointestinal motility.
  • Acetylcholinesterase Inhibition: It inhibits the enzyme responsible for breaking down acetylcholine. By maintaining higher levels of acetylcholine, the medication strengthens the signals that trigger digestive muscle contractions.

These combined actions facilitate gastric emptying and improve the coordination between the stomach and the beginning of the small intestine.

Therapeutic Use

Itoprid PMCS is typically indicated for the treatment of functional dyspepsia and other non-ulcer digestive issues. It is intended to address a specific cluster of symptoms that occur when the digestive system does not move food efficiently. These symptoms often include:

  • A sensation of pressure or fullness in the upper abdomen.
  • Abdominal pain or discomfort.
  • Loss of appetite.
  • Heartburn.
  • Nausea and vomiting.

By improving gastric tone and motility, the medication helps alleviate the physical discomfort caused by slow digestion.

What side effects are possible with Itoprid PMCS?

Possible side effects and safety information

Itoprid PMCS's safety profile is documented by government regulatory bodies, classifying potential effects primarily by frequency and the body system affected. All adverse reactions are based on official post-marketing reports and clinical trial data.

Frequency Category Representative Adverse Reactions
Uncommon ( ge 1/1,000 to <1/100) Leucopenia, Headache, Dizziness, Diarrhoea, Constipation, Abdominal pain, Hyperprolactinaemia, Fatigue.
Rare ( ge 1/10,000 to <1/1,000) Rash, Erythema, Pruritus.
Not Known (Frequency cannot be estimated) Thrombocytopenia, Anaphylactoid reaction, Jaundice, Gynecomastia, Nausea, Tremor, and abnormal liver enzyme increases (e.g., AST, ALT, Bilirubin).

System-Organ-Classes Involved

Adverse events are officially grouped into categories including Gastrointestinal Disorders, Nervous System Disorders, Endocrine Disorders, Blood and Lymphatic System Disorders, and transient changes listed under Investigations.

Serious Adverse Reactions and Contraindications

The label states that no serious adverse reactions were observed during clinical trials. However, post-marketing data lists events such as Anaphylactoid reaction and Thrombocytopenia as having a Not Known frequency.

The medicine is contraindicated and must not be used in patients where increased gastrointestinal motility could be harmful, such as in cases of gastrointestinal haemorrhage, mechanical obstruction, or perforation. Patients with certain rare hereditary problems, such as galactose intolerance due to the excipient lactose, should also not use this medicine.

Population-Specific Safety Considerations

Specific caution and careful monitoring are advised for older adults and patients with reduced hepatic or renal function. Safety has not been established in children under 16 years of age. Use during pregnancy or lactation is not recommended due to insufficient safety data.

Overdose and Emergency Response

Overdose and When to Seek Help

The official regulatory documentation for Itoprid PMCS (Itopride hydrochloride) outlines the necessary management based on available clinical data. The Summary of Product Characteristics (SmPC) states that no cases of overdose in humans have been formally reported, meaning specific clinical manifestations and dose-related toxicities are not documented in the official prescribing information.

When to Seek Immediate Medical Attention A suspected or excessive overdose necessitates seeking consultation with a healthcare provider immediately for necessary assessment and management. Emergency actions and treatment are strictly procedural:

  • Antidote Status: No specific antidote is known for Itopride overdose.
  • Supportive Measures: Management includes the application of gastric lavage to minimize drug absorption and provision of symptomatic and supportive therapy to manage any developing clinical effects.

Therapeutic Uses of Itoprid PMCS

What Itoprid PMCS Treats: Main Uses and Benefits

Itoprid PMCS is commonly used to help with symptoms related to Functional Dyspepsia (FD) in adults, a chronic condition characterized by upper gastrointestinal (GI) discomfort where no structural disease is found. The medication is commonly used to help with symptoms such as postprandial fullness, early satiety, epigastric pain, and associated nausea and vomiting.

It addresses symptom clusters that may become intense or disruptive, including abdominal distension or bloating, providing supportive relief that generally contributes to easing the overall symptom load. This medication is applied across domains where additional symptomatic support is needed, for instance, in cases of Chronic Gastritis and is relevant when symptoms are recurrent or episodic.

It supports general well-being during symptomatic phases, assisting with maintaining functional stability when these symptoms interfere with routine activities. It is also considered relevant as add-on therapy for symptoms of Gastroesophageal Reflux Disease (GERD) when patients experience concurrent motility issues.

Eligibility and Restrictions for Use

Eligibility Scope

Category Official Regulatory Status
Populations for whom use is allowed Adults (the officially indicated population) [Source 1.1, 2.4].
Populations for whom use is not recommended Children under 16 years; Breastfeeding women [Source 1.1, 2.2].
Populations for whom use is contraindicated Patients with hypersensitivity to Itopride or any excipients [Source 2.4]; Patients with conditions where increased gastrointestinal motility could be harmful [Source 1.1, 2.4].

Age- and Condition-Based Restrictions

  • Absolute Contraindications: The medicine must not be used by patients with gastrointestinal haemorrhage, mechanical obstruction, or perforation [Source 1.1]. Patients with rare hereditary problems like galactose intolerance should also avoid use due to the lactose content [Source 3.1].
  • Pediatric Use: Safety and efficacy have not been established in the pediatric population (under 16 years) [Source 2.2].
  • Older Adults (Geriatric): Requires adequate caution and careful monitoring, reflecting the greater frequency of decreased organ function in this group [Source 2.4].
  • Organ Impairment: Patients with reduced hepatic or renal functions must be carefully monitored; therapy adjustment or discontinuation may be necessary [Source 3.1].

Pregnancy and Lactation Eligibility

  • Pregnancy: Safety has not been verified. Use is permitted only if therapeutic benefits outweigh possible risks considerably [Source 1.1].
  • Lactation: Use is not recommended for nursing mothers, as Itopride is excreted in animal milk and human data are limited [Source 1.1].

What should I know about interactions with other medicines?

Interactions with other medicines and products

Official regulatory documents define the interaction profile of Itoprid PMCS based primarily on its effect on gastrointestinal movement and its specific metabolic route.

Pharmacokinetic and Pharmacodynamic Interactions

The most significant interaction risk arises from its prokinetic action, which could influence the absorption of concurrently administered oral medicines. This cautionary statement applies especially to drugs with a narrow therapeutic index and those formulated as sustained-release or enteric-coated products, as their plasma exposure may be modified.

Conversely, the effect of Itoprid PMCS may be reduced by specific co-administered agents. Anticholinergic drugs may lessen the intended prokinetic action of the medicine.

Regarding metabolism, official labeling indicates that metabolic interactions involving the Cytochrome P450 (CYP450) enzyme system are not expected. Itopride is primarily metabolized by the Flavine Monooxygenase (FMO) system. Studies have also documented that the prokinetic action of Itoprid PMCS is not affected by co-administration with anti-ulcer drugs such as cimetidine or ranitidine.

Restrictions and Population Notes

The use of Itoprid PMCS is formally restricted when increased gastrointestinal motility poses a risk, specifically in conditions such as gastrointestinal hemorrhage, mechanical obstruction, or perforation. Furthermore, patients with reduced hepatic or renal function require careful monitoring, as do elderly patients, due to potential changes in drug clearance.

Mechanism of Action

Itopride operates through a synergistic dual mechanism of action centered on enhancing the activity of the stimulatory neurotransmitter Acetylcholine ( ACh) within the gut wall. This action is primarily peripheral, affecting the Enteric Nervous System (ENS) with minimal brain penetration.

Dual Molecular Targets: Removing Inhibition and Prolonging Stimulation

This mechanism describes the molecule's action on both an inhibitory receptor and a breakdown enzyme. Itopride simultaneously targets the Dopamine D2 Receptors ( DD2 Rs) by acting as an antagonist (blocker) and inhibits the Acetylcholinesterase ( AChE) enzyme. Blocking the DD2 Rs removes the natural inhibitory control that Dopamine exerts on ACh release, while AChE inhibition prevents ACh from being rapidly broken down, leading to an increased local concentration of the stimulatory neurotransmitter.

Mechanistic Cascade to Propulsive Contraction

This cascade describes how the molecular activity is translated into movement. The amplified concentration of ACh stimulates Muscarinic M3 receptors on the gut's smooth muscle cells, which in turn enhances the influx of calcium ions. This internal chemical signaling leads to stronger, more frequent, and coordinated peristaltic contractions throughout the stomach and duodenum, which results in the rapid, forward movement of contents.

Dosage and Administration Information

Itoprid PMCS is provided as a 50 mg film-coated tablet intended for oral administration.

Official Dosing and Administration

The standard adult dose is 150 mg of itopride hydrochloride daily. This total daily dose is achieved using a divided use pattern where one 50 mg tablet is taken three times a day. The most crucial instruction for timing is that each dose must be taken before meals to synchronize the drug's effect with the start of digestion. The maximum recommended daily dose is 150 mg.

Procedural Element Official Instruction
Administration Route Oral, via tablet.
Standard Daily Dose 150 mg (three times 50 mg tablets).
Frequency and Timing Three times a day, before meals.
Tablet Handling Tablets must be swallowed whole with liquid; the score line is for ease of swallowing, not dose division.

Use in Specific Populations

Use in the pediatric population is not established; therefore, the medicine is not recommended for children and adolescents. For older adults and patients with hepatic or renal impairment, caution is required, and the therapeutic plan must allow for dose reduction or discontinuation if adverse reactions occur, reflecting a necessary adjustment to the standard regimen. The duration of use is typically limited to a defined course of therapy, generally not extending beyond eight weeks.

Recent Clinical Evidence

Research Evidence / Overview of Studies for Itoprid PMCS

Research Evidence for Functional Dyspepsia (FD) and Motility Symptoms

The most extensive research on Itoprid PMCS has been applied in studies examining patient-reported experiences related to Functional Dyspepsia (FD). The evidence primarily comes from Randomized, Double-Blind, Placebo-Controlled Trials (RCTs) that evaluated patient groups randomly assigned to receive either the medicine or an inactive placebo. These trials have been compiled and analyzed in larger meta-analyses to synthesize data from the studies.

Researchers focused on specific patient-reported outcomes describing perceived discomfort. The main outcomes related to physical discomfort studied included changes in the severity of postprandial fullness and early satiety, as well as an overall Global Patient Assessment (GPA). Findings describe patterns observed in the studies over defined time intervals, typically lasting 4 to 8 weeks. Some meta-analyses describing patterns of symptom change observed in patient groups compared to those who received placebo.

Studies Examining Symptomatic Support for GERD

The research scope also includes studies where Itoprid PMCS was evaluated in conditions characterized by fluctuating or episodic manifestations like Gastroesophageal Reflux Disease (GERD). These trials were generally structured as retrospective observational settings or smaller controlled trials applied in research contexts where the medicine was evaluated alongside existing Proton Pump Inhibitor (PPI) therapy.

Long-Term Research and Evidence Gaps

The core, controlled clinical trials for Itoprid PMCS were designed to assess short-term symptom changes. To understand patterns over extended periods, some researchers have conducted open-label extension studies, with follow-up durations sometimes tracked for up to 6 months or 1 year. This evidence describes data available regarding prolonged usage.

However, the long-term effects are not fully established because the follow-up durations were limited in terms of controlled, blinded data. Data for outcomes reflecting long-term maintenance remain insufficient. Furthermore, head-to-head comparative evidence is lacking against certain other treatments for motility disorders, and specific data regarding the study of the medicine in children and older adults remain insufficient within the core regulatory evidence.

How should Itoprid PMCS be stored and disposed of?

How to Store and Dispose of Itoprid PMCS?

The official regulatory profile indicates that Itoprid PMCS film-coated tablets do not require any special storage conditions, confirming stability over its five-year shelf life at normal room temperatures. The product is supplied in sealed blister packaging inside a carton.

Essential Storage and Disposal Rules

Area Requirement
Child Safety Keep this medicine out of the sight and reach of children.
Disposal Method Dispose of unused or expired product in accordance with local requirements.
Environmental Rule Do not throw away this medicine via wastewater or household waste to protect the environment.

It is mandatory to return old or unused medicines to a pharmacy or authorized collection point.
